It was my pleasure to spend four wonderful days at Saint Mary-of-the-Woods.  It is the site of the Mother House for the Sisters of Providence of Saint Mary-of-the-Woods and Saint Mary-of-the-Woods College.  But first and foremost is was the destination of Saint Mother Theodore Guerin in 1840.


























The Cabin
Saint Mary -of-the-Woods
 Replica

Let's here from Mother Theodore as she shares her words on her arrival at The Woods in 1840.  You can only imagine.

"I cannot tell you what passed within me during the next half hour.  I do not know myself, but I was  so deeply moved that I could not utter a word.  We continued to advance into the thick woods till suddenly Father Buteaux stopped the carriage and said, 'Come down, Sisters, we have arrived.'  What was our astonishment to find ourselves still in the midst of the forest, no village, not even a house in sight...[L]ed down into the ravine, whence we beheld through the trees on the other side a frame house with a stable and some sheds.  'There,' he said, 'is the house where the postulants have a room, and where you will lodge until your house is ready.'"
" We had agreed aong ourselve that our first visit would be made to the Blessed Sacrament, and that we soule not speak to anyone before having satiasfied this longing of our hearts.  The priest preceded us and we followed in silence to the Church.  The Church!!"

The church was a cabin, just as the pictures of the replica show above.  This was where Father said Mass and had only a cot in the corner where he could sleep.  Rude church but miracles still  happened here!


















Today the Sisters and all who visit can enter and worship in the Church of the Immaculate Conception. You can walk the holy grounds.  You can enter into the silence.  The trees are the friends of reflection.  The buildings honor the wisdom of Saint Mother Theodore and all the Sisters of Providence since.  I find every time I visit I have been touched again by the love, energy, compassion and willingness to give of those who follow the charism of Saint Mother Theodore and the Sisters of Providence.
